Currently, webpack --quiet ignores the files passed, while still outputting to the console:

Hash: 6dbc5ab44333d067d673
Version: webpack 1.4.0-beta6
Time: 11ms

It would be nice to have the --quiet option work as expected, i.e. silence all non-error messages.
